Frequently Asked Questions about Mojave

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Mojave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Mojave ranges from $1,050 to $2,740 with an average monthly rent of $1,877.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Mojave c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Mojave range from $762 to $3,484.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,074.

How expensive are Mojave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 27 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Mojave on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,631 to $3,708 - averaging $3,128 for the location.
